---------- Chapter 43 -----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

Crap! What do I do? Usually I’m the one falling to pieces and Haden’s the strong one.

I shake my head a couple of times to clear it before I kneel opposite Haden. He has his face in his hands and his entire body is wrecked.

               “Haden,” I coo, pulling him towards me.

He allows me to and after a moment, he’s leaning against me, still weeping a little. I’ve never really seen a grown guy cry and it makes me feel so bad! I’ve seen Haden go through so much. For him to break down like this...he must be in so much pain!

               “It’s alright Haden,” I whisper, tangling a hand in his thick hair and the other wrapped around his back.

               “My father was right, I am a sorry excuse for a reaper,” Haden mutters against my shoulders, his voice slightly nasal.

               “Hey, don’t say that,” I whisper, holding his shoulders at arm’s length.

He gives me a small lopsided smile, his eyes still glistening a little. “I need to man up,” he jokes after a minutes, wiping his face against him sleeve.

               “I think you need to be yourself more,” I murmur, tracing his jaw line with the back of my hand.

               “What? I am myself,” he mutters a little like a little kid being falsely accused of cheating during an exam; extremely defensive.

               “You’re always the strong one! You can break down once in a while too, Haden. It’s healthy. Plus, it makes you so much more human,” I whisper, wiping away the traces of his tears.

               “I’m not a human Jess,” he teases, kissing my fingertips.

               “And that, my love, is very, very sexy,” I whisper huskily.

He raises his eyebrows flirtatiously before the both of us burst into laughter. Haden wraps me in his warm embrace, resting his cheek against the top of my head.

               “I love you,” he reminds me, his tone cheerful again.

               “I love you too, even if you possibly have better break downs then me,” I tease.

Haden pulls away from me and gives me his best glare before getting up. He pulls me to my feet and wraps an arm around my waist.

               “So, whatcha say my love? Wanna get married?” he asks lightly, kissing my cheek.

               “Hmm, no,” I murmur easily.

               “Excuse me?” he demands, his tone completely incredulous.

               “What? You think that just because I’m knocked up that I’m desperate? You gotta work to win me over Mr. Carter,” I tease coyly.

               “Oh yeah? I like a challenge soon-to-be Mrs Carter,” he purrs, making me shiver in anticipation.

               “Hey Haden, where are Matt and Alex,” I ask suddenly. I had completely forgotten about them.

               “Gee, that wasn’t a mood killer or anything Jess,” Haden mutters sarcastically. “Hmm, Matt and Alex? They came back here after we set off into the palace. They didn’t really want to stay for the ensuing drama,” he murmurs simply.

Haden leads me towards the door as he grabs our coats and his keys. “Where are we going?” I finally ask as he holds the door open for me to climb into his car. He merely smiles and closes the door gently.

Only once he’s in the car and we’ve already started moving does he clear his throat. “We’re going to go to gynaecologist,” he murmurs, clearly uncomfortable.

               “What?!” I shriek. No way! I’m not ready for this!

               “Babe, calm down. We’ll just go and make sure everything is okay,” he promises, taking my hand and rubbing soothing circles into my palm.

               “No! I’ve never been to a gynaecologist before! I’m not ready!” I protest quickly.

               “Jess, I’m sorry, but you have no choice. I know you’re afraid and I know it’s going to be embarrassing and all, but we have to do this,” he murmurs. It might just be my imagination, but I think Haden sped up a little.

               “Haden, please? Another day! I need to mentally prepare myself,” I plead.

               “Prepare yourself? If I give you any more time, you’ll chicken out. It’s going to be fine Jess. The doctor will just check you out and then I’ll take you out for dinner anywhere you like, okay?” he bargains, bringing my hand up to his lips so he could kiss me reassuringly.

               “Haden do you know the kind of torture that goes on in a gyno exam?” I demand, my face heating up. “I’ll have to put my legs into those things that keep the leg’s apart-”

               “Stirrups,” he murmurs easily, grinning a little.

               “Fine, stirrups!” I huff. “I’ll have to let a doctor poke around down there! Are you crazy?! And I heard they even do this crazy thing where they put something in you!” I shudder. I could jump out of a moving car right? I mean they do it in movies all the time!

               “I think that sounds pretty hot actually,” Haden whispers huskily, giving me a wink.

I glare at him before continuing my freak out. Nobody can force me to have an examination right? I can refuse to get out of my jeans!

               “Come on Jess, do it for me, please? I just want to make sure both you and the baby are okay,” he pleads softly. “I won’t even come into the room if it’ll embarrass you.”

               “Haden I told you! I want an abortion,” I whisper timidly.

               “You could talk to the doctor about an abortion, love. But you’re going to need my consent. You’re a kid and without the consent of a parent or guardian, nobody in their right mind would allow it,” he murmurs easily, shrugging. Damn it! He knows I have no choice.

               “It’s not fair! It’s my body! I don’t want to swell up like a whale!” I mutter darkly.

Haden grins and rubs my hand with his. “You won’t. I won’t let you. Besides, once the baby is out you can work out and get your perfect body back. But we’re getting off topic here. We’ll deal with this whole baby thing after the trip to the gynaecologist,” Haden murmurs with a ring of finality in his voice.

               “So I gotta deal with some stranger probing around while you sit on the seat and laugh?” I mumble angrily.

               “Hey, it won’t be so bad. I’ll hold your hand through it all if that would make you feel better. Swear I won’t take a peek,” he promises teasingly.

Haden pulls up in the parking lot and holds his hand out for me. “Babe, your face is so red!” he comments, pulling me into his side so I could lean against him. “I know you’re embarrassed. But everyone does this. The doctor will be very professional,” he promises, kissing my forehead.

I glare at him angrily, but I don’t have the energy to try and argue with him. I know Haden. And when Haden makes up his mind, come hell or high water, he won’t change it.

He walks me into the hospital and leads me over to one of the uncomfortable little plastic chairs. I’m blushing so much that my entire body is red! Haden chuckles a little when he sees me before walking off to the counter to sign me in or make an appointment or whatever.

After a few minutes, he returns and takes a seat beside me. “There’s two doctors, a male and a female. The guy has more experience. Would you be more comfortable with the lady? Personally I think we should go for the guy. Even the nurse seemed to say so. The woman isn’t very gentle,” Haden murmurs.

               “Your choice,” I mutter sourly.

Haden sighs a little but gets up to talk to the lady behind the counter again. The both of them start laughing a little and my blush intensifies. Haden takes his seat beside me and pulls me against him, stroking my hair, trying his best to keep me calm.

After more than an hour, an incredibly good-looking man steps out of one of the rooms and gestures for us to enter. Oh my god! Please don’t let that be the doctor! This will be so embarrassing! I knew I should have told Haden I wanted the woman! Damn it!
